C语言I作业08
C语言I作业08 这个作业属于哪个课程 C语言程序设计ll 这个作业的要求在哪里 https://edu.cnblogs.com/campus/zswxy/SE2019-2/homework/9981 我在这个课程的目标是 学会do-while和while语句,看翁凯老师的视频 这个作业在哪个具体方面帮助我实现目标 PTA作业 参考文献 《C语言程序设计》 PTA实验作业 1.1 题目7-1求整数的位数及各位数字之和 题目内容描述:对于给定的正整数N,求它的位数及其各位数字之和。 1.1.1 数据处理 (1.)数据表达:定义整形变量N,z,h分别代表输入的正整数,整数位数,各位数之和。 (2.)数据处理:使用了while语句进行循环,通过N的取余再将余数相加可得其各位数之和,再通过N反复除以10,得到的整数通过计数器来累计可得其位数。 (3.)伪代码: 1.1.2 实验代码截图 1.1.3 造测试数据 数据输入 数据输出 说明 123 3 6 三位数 各位数和为6 456 3 15 三位数 各位数和为15 789 3 24 三位数 各位数和为24 159 3 15 三位数 各位数和为15 1.1.4 PTA提交列表及说明 提交列表说明 1.部分正确:未用%来取余。 2.部分正确:未将z,h进行初始化。 3.部分正确:将赋值符号写成了等于符号。 4.部分正确:while(!=0